The Qatar Central Bank (QCB) has launched the 43 ‘Eidiya ATMs’ across nine locations in the country to facilitate the traditional practice of giving cash gifts during Eid.

This move is designed to streamline the process and ensure that residents can more easily participate in this traditional practice.

The machines, which are available from March 10, dispense fresh banknotes in denominations of $1.38 (QR5), $2.76 (QR10), $13.78 (QR50), $27.56 (QR100), and $55.12 (QR200).

The Eidiya ATMs have been installed at several major shopping and commercial locations. These include Place Vendome (8 ATMs), Doha Festival City (7), Mall of Qatar (4), Al Wakrah Old Souq (4), Al Hazm Mall (4), West Walk (4), Al Khor Mall (4), Al Meera in Muaither (4), and Al Meera in Al Thumama (4).

According to QCB, the initiative is designed to make it easier for residents to obtain small-denomination banknotes traditionally used for Eidiya, the cash gifts given to children and family members during Eid celebrations.

The central bank said that the service also aims to preserve Qatari cultural traditions by reviving the practice of distributing Eidi in the form of newly issued currency notes during festive occasions.

The ATMs are typically introduced ahead of Eid holidays, when demand for fresh banknotes rises as families prepare to exchange gifts during Eid Al Fitr and Eid Al Adha, as per the statement.
